Job Description - Control -M SME




Control-M Automation Engineer (Infrastructure & API Expert)







At Nöord Technologies, we empower top-tier financial institutions with exceptional talent in banking and capital markets. We are currently seeking, on behalf of one of our clients, a high-caliber Control-M SME.













The Mission

As a Control-M Expert, you are more than an administrator; you are the architect of our mission-critical operational scheduling. You will join a dynamic team where your role is to modernize our infrastructure through automation (API) and ensure the absolute resilience of our complex global systems.





Key Challenges & Responsibilities



  • Modernization & Innovation: Drive our Control-M infrastructure into the future by leveraging Automation APIs and integrations to transform traditional scheduling into "Everything as Code".


  • Solution Architecture: Partner with the business to translate complex requirements into robust, scalable technical designs.






  • Complex Batch Orchestration: Lead the configuration and implementation of sophisticated Control-M batch streams, ensuring high-quality standards throughout the release lifecycle.






  • Critical Problem Solving: Act as the technical lead for escalated incidents (P1–P4), conducting deep-dive Root Cause Analysis (RCA) to proactively strengthen our environment.






  • Strategic Collaboration: Work alongside cross-functional teams and third-party vendors to orchestrate seamless change management and infrastructure hardening.


Your Profile



  • Technical Leadership: You enjoy providing expert guidance to your peers and fostering a culture of technical excellence.






  • Automation Mindset: You have a proactive approach to troubleshooting and a passion for streamlining infrastructure through modern tools.






  • Quality & Compliance Advocate: You are dedicated to meeting service level expectations while following rigorous incident and change management policies.











Requirements

Your Profile: The Ideal Expert

The Foundation



  • Educational Background: You hold a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, IT, or have equivalent high-level field experience.


  • Proven Track Record: You bring 8 to 10 years of solid experience in enterprise-level scheduling and automation environments.


Core Technical Mastery



  • Control-M Specialist: Deep architectural knowledge of Control-M, with hands-on expertise in v9.21 and v9.22 (installation, configuration, and Disaster Recovery).


  • Migration Veteran: You have successfully navigated through multiple Control-M releases and handled complex environment migrations.


  • Platform Versatility: Proficient in Linux OS and experienced in managing agents across Windows (2016 to 2022) and all current UNIX/Linux distributions.


  • Advanced Features: Full command of MFT/AFT, Configuration Manager, Forecasting, and security protocols.


Modern Engineering & Integration



  • API & Automation: Strong proficiency with the Control-M Automation API to drive infrastructure modernization.


  • File Transfer Ecosystem: Beyond Control-M, you possess valuable knowledge of file transfer products like CFT, Connect Direct, MQ Series, or Secure Transport.


  • Complex Troubleshooting: A sharp analytical mind capable of resolving Level 4 issues in direct collaboration with BMC support.


Mindset & Operations



  • Service Excellence: Solid understanding of ITIL frameworks, specifically integrating Incident, Problem, and Change Management (IPC).


  • Dynamic & Reliable: Ready to support US-based operations with a flexible mindset for business-critical weekend work when required.



Work Environment & Logistics



  • Location: Montreal (Hybrid model).


  • Onboarding: To ensure a smooth integration, the first 3 months will be 100% on-site, transitioning to 3 days in-office thereafter.


  • Schedule: Standard business hours (8:30 AM – 5:00 PM ET) following the USA calendar.


  • Language: Professional fluency in English is mandatory.
